Passos 1,41Grupo de Imunogenética Molecular, Departamento de Genética, Faculdade de Medicina de Ribeirão Preto, Universidadede São Paulo (USP), Ribeirão Preto; 2 Universidade Federal de São Carlos, Programa de Genética e Evolução, SãoCarlos, SP, Brasil; 3 Unité INSERM Technologies Avancées pour le Génome et la Clinique, Marseille, France; 4 Disciplinade Genética, Faculdade de O<strong>do</strong>ntologia de Ribeirão Preto, USP, Ribeirão Preto, SP, BrasilReceived 13 September 2002; accepted 17 February 2003AbstractThe V(D)J recombination of TCRα and β in early developing T-cells is a highly modulated phenomenon initiated and completedby recombinase complex (RAG-1 and RAG-2), and regulated by other <strong>gene</strong> products such as interleukins. To furtherevaluate the association of several other <strong>gene</strong> products with the evolution of TCRVβ8.1 V(D)J rearrangements in vivo, themRNA expression levels of seven interleukins, three cytokines, receptors TCRVβ8.1 and IL-2Rβ, MHC-I/MHC-II, RAG-1/RAG-2 and retroviral superantigen MMTV(SW) were measured by RT-PCR during the fetal development of the thymus ofthree inbred mouse strains (Balb-c, C57Bl/6 and CBA/J). Clustering using the Tree View software, was used to organize these<strong>gene</strong>s based on similarity of expression patterns. Each strain displayed a different expression profile during thymus ontogeny.During the late developmental stage the most evident association was the kinetics of MMTV(SW) retrovirus, IL-2Rβ andIL-7 overexpression with reduction of TCRVβ8.1-Dβ2.1 rearrangement in the thymus of CBA/J mice. These data suggest asusceptibility of this strain to expression of MMTV(SW) upon reduction of the rearranged TCRVβ8.1-Dβ2.1 segment in developingthymocytes, with parallel IL-7 overexpression. (Mol Cell Biochem 252: 223–228, 2003)Key words: TCRVβ8.1, V(D)J recombination, <strong>gene</strong> expression profiling, cytokine, cluster analysis.IntroductionNon-manipulated inbred mouse strains constitute a modelsystem for studies on the effects of different <strong>gene</strong>tic backgroundson the in vivo maturation of thymocytes. In previouswork, we have observed that onset of T-cell receptor(TCRα/β) V(D)J recombination differs among the Balb-c,C57Bl/6 and CBA/J strains [1, 2].The V(D)J recombination in early developing T-cells is ahighly modulated phenomenon. The rearrangements of T-cellreceptor <strong>gene</strong>s (TCRα and β) is initiated and completed bythe recombinase enzymatic complex (RAG-1 and RAG-2),but is regulated by other <strong>gene</strong> products such as interleukins[3, 4].Stromal cells from the thymus or bone marrow are veryimportant for development of T-cells producing cytokines [5,6]. In this context, interleukin (IL)-7 in particular appears toserve as a proliferative agent before and after <strong>gene</strong> rearrangementsand possibly as a survival factor during rearrangements[7].Address for offprints: G.A.S.
